The Spice Islands in a broad sense include the entire South Ocean, including Borneo, Java, New Guinea, and Sumatra.

In a narrow sense, the Banda Islands and the Bacchan Islands are sometimes called the Spice Islands, and they are the main producing areas of cloves.

Initially, Portugal controlled the islands. But Portugal is too wasteful, and the natives often teach them how to behave. The most typical example is the "Ternate War".

Ternate Island, with an area of ​​only 106 square kilometers, has a sultanate established by indigenous people.

Where the fart is bigger, the resistance is stronger. At the beginning of the attack on Portuguese villages, the Portuguese relied on negotiation and compromise to barely maintain peace. Then, Portugal built castles, but the castles were captured by the islanders and all Portuguese colonists were killed.

It was not until Portugal was annexed to Spain that Spain and Portugal joined forces to retake Ternate Island. In just a few years, the natives on the island rioted again and drove away the Portuguese and Spanish.

The natives of a small island are so strong, but the army of these colonists is really weak.

Then, the Dutch came.

The Dutch learned the lessons of their predecessors and began to play the trick of massacre. On various islands, they consciously carried out long-term massacres, specifically selecting the food harvest season to kill the indigenous people, steal the food, and burn down the houses. This continued for more than ten years, causing the number of indigenous people on these islands to continue to decrease, and they were almost driven back to primitive society.

It was not until the number of indigenous people dropped sharply that the Netherlands truly began to colonize and use Ternate Island as a base of rule. It was not until the capture of Batavia that the Governor's Palace of the Dutch East India Company was moved from Ternate Island to Batavia.

In order to monopolize the clove trade, the Dutch even killed all the British people on Ambon Island. Then all the clove trees on other islands were destroyed, and cloves were only allowed to be planted intensively on Ambon Island, thus successfully controlling the supply of cloves.
